The video explores the differences between being nice and being kind in the workplace. Niceness often involves pleasing others for short-term benefits, while kindness focuses on providing genuine support, even if it involves uncomfortable truths. The video emphasizes the importance of kindness over niceness, especially in fostering inclusion and addressing systemic inequities. It suggests that workplaces should prioritize kindness to encourage meaningful conversations and support the greater good.
